We asked nearly 300 people to fill out our Redemption Church Experience Survey in January 2020 . After numerous hours of study, the only mandate the elders found was that we need to have our own building. (we are working on that!)

There were a few items that, although not indicating an overwhelming issue, we thought we needed to address. Since the surveys were anonymous we cannot reach out to individuals but we did want to offer what we hope would be explanations or solutions to these issues.


MUSIC VOLUME
A handful of people mentioned that the worship music can be too loud. We had to weigh this against the overwhelmingly positive response from the survey to the worship music.

One of the difficulties of our current location is the limits of the CHS theater.  One of those limits is the acoustics. Since we cannot modify the room, we are limited to what we can do.  However, we are in the process of changing our amplification system in hopes that the room will be more acoustically balanced.
